And assuredly Nuh cried unto us; and We are the Best of answerers! 75 We saved him and his people from great distress, 76 and We made his offspring the only survivors. 77 We left mention of him among later generations. 78 Peace be unto Noah among the peoples! 79 Thus indeed do we reward those who do right. 80 Surely he was one of Our truly believing servants. 81 We drowned all the others (besides Noah and his people). 82 ۞ And verily of his sect was Ibrahim. 83 he came to his Lord with a sound heart. 84 and when he said to his father and to his nation: 'What do you worship? 85 Is it falsehood [as] gods other than Allah you desire? 86 What, then, do you think of the Sustainer of all the worlds?" 87 Then he cast a glance at the stars (to deceive them), 88 Then he said: Surely I am sick (of your worshipping these). 89 so they turned their backs on him and went off. 90 Then did he turn to their gods and said, "will ye not eat (of the offerings before you)?... 91 "What is the matter with you that ye speak not (intelligently)?" 92 And he turned upon them a blow with [his] right hand. 93 Then came (the worshippers) with hurried steps, and faced (him). 94 He said, "How can you worship what you yourselves have carved 95 when it is God who has created you and all your handiwork?" 96 They said: "Build for him a building (it is said that the building was like a furnace) and throw him into the blazing fire!" 97 And they devised a plot for him, but We made them the humble. 98 (Abraham) said, "I will go to my Lord who will guide me". 99 My Lord! Vouchsafe me of the righteous. 100 (In response to this prayer) We gave him the good news of a prudent boy; 101 And when (his son) was old enough to walk with him, (Abraham) said: O my dear son, I have seen in a dream that I must sacrifice thee. So look, what thinkest thou? He said: O my father! Do that which thou art commanded. Allah willing, thou shalt find me of the steadfast. 102 When both surrendered (to Allah's command) and Abraham flung the son down on his forehead, 103 We called out to him "O Abraham! 104 thou hast confirmed the vision; even so We recompense the good-doers. 105 This is indeed the manifest trial.' 106 And We rescued him in exchange of a great sacrifice. (The sacrifice of Ibrahim and Ismail peace be upon them is commemorated every year on 10, 11 and 12 Zil Haj). 107 And We left (this blessing) for him among generations (to come) in later times: 108 "Peace be upon Abraham!" 109 Thus indeed do We reward those who do right. 110 He is indeed one of Our high ranking, firmly believing bondmen. 111 And We gave him the good news of Isaac, a Prophet and among the righteous ones. 112 And We blessed him and Isaac. But among their descendants is the doer of good and the clearly unjust to himself. 113
